Common Water Heater Issues in Plymouth
- No hot water: A failed heating element, thermostat, thermocouple, or gas valve leaves your Plymouth home without hot water, a serious problem in the depths of a Minnesota winter.
- Leaking water heater: Loose connections, a faulty T&P valve, a worn drain valve, or tank corrosion can all cause leaks in Plymouth basements and utility rooms.
- Pilot light will not stay lit: A faulty thermocouple, dirty pilot orifice, or drafts in a cold basement can keep snuffing it out in Plymouth homes.
- Sediment buildup and rumbling noises: Mineral sediment settling in the bottom of a tank-style heater produces rumbling, popping, and reduced efficiency, and it makes the unit work even harder against cold incoming water.
- Anode-rod corrosion: A spent anode rod is a leading cause of tank rust, and checking it regularly protects your Plymouth unit.
- Inconsistent temperature: A failing thermostat, scaled element, or aging unit produces hot-then-cold water that needs professional diagnosis.

Types of Water Heaters We Install in Plymouth
We work with the full range of systems found across Plymouth:
- Tank water heaters (gas and electric), known for simple, reliable storage-based hot water and strong recovery in cold-climate basements.
- Tankless water heaters (gas and electric), delivering on-demand hot water while freeing up space, sized to handle Minnesota's cold incoming water.
- Hybrid heat pump water heaters, combining a tank with heat-pump technology for high efficiency.
When to Repair vs. Replace in Plymouth
Age, repair history, and condition guide the decision. A newer unit with a single failed part is usually worth repairing. A unit past its expected lifespan with rusty water, recurring leaks, or repeated failures is often a better candidate for replacement, and the extra strain of heating cold Minnesota water can age a tank sooner. Repair and Maintenance for Long Unit Life in Plymouth
Most water heater problems give early warning. Discolored or rusty hot water, a rumbling or popping tank, longer recovery times, or moisture around the base all signal that service is due. Annual flushing clears sediment, an anode-rod check slows tank corrosion, and a T&P valve test confirms the unit can relieve pressure safely. Keeping the basement utility area from getting too cold also protects the lines feeding the unit. Prevention Tips for Plymouth Homeowners
- Flush the tank annually to clear sediment that settles in the bottom.
- Have the anode rod checked regularly to slow tank corrosion.
- Test the T&P valve to confirm it relieves pressure safely.
- Keep the basement utility area above freezing so the lines feeding the unit do not freeze in a Minnesota cold snap.
- Schedule an annual inspection, especially for units past ten years of service in your Plymouth home.
